Rosario Begoña Casado Sobrino (1961 – 15 July 2021) was a Spanish politician and pharmacist.[1] A member of the People's Party (PP), she served in the Senate of Spain from 2004 to 2008.[2]
After earning her pharmacy license, she owned and operated a pharmacy in Albacete. She was a member of the Regional Executive Committee of the People's Party in Albacete, serving in the city council[3] and once running for Mayor.[2] She later served as a Senator in the from 2004 to 2008,[4] serving in the Mixed Commission for Women's Rights and Equal Opportunities, Health and Consumer Commission, and the Joint Commission on Health, Consumption, Labor and Social Affairs.[5]
Rosario Casado died in Albacete on 15 July 2021.[6]
